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.10.03;
Скачать: CL | DM;

Вниз

как сохранить изменения в Interbase   Найти похожие ветки 

 
id_privin ©   (2002-09-06 18:48) [0]

Есть Data : TIbDataSet; В нем прописанны все 5 SQL выражений.

Пытаюсь редактировать запись. Если делаю это через Grid то все нормально : сказал Commit,Refresh все сохраняеися. Теперь делаю так

Data.Edit;
Data.FieldByName("A").asString := "FOO";
Data.Post;

Data.ApplyUpdates;
Trans.Commit;

И получаю старые данные. Причем после установки нового значения поля оно отображается, а после Commit,Refresh получаю старое.

Как меня лечить?


 
Desdechado ©   (2002-09-06 21:14) [1]

не мешало бы явно транзакцию начать


 
Leran2002 ©   (2002-09-07 06:52) [2]

Data.Transaction.Commit;
или
Data.Transaction.CommitRetaining;


 
Севостьянов Игорь ©   (2002-09-07 14:00) [3]

>>Как меня лечить?
Можно пивом попробовать вылечить (шутка)

либо просто убрать // Trans.Commit;


 
kostik78ua   (2002-09-12 17:51) [4]

Вместо Data.ApplyUpdates пиши IBDatabase.ApplyUpdates([Data])
Ну и конечно см. Севостьянов Игорь



Страницы: 1 вся ветка

Текущий архив: 2002.10.03;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.016 c
1-7987
vadim2
2002-09-20 13:51
2002.10.03
как сделать, чтобы dbgrid обрабатывал wm_paste?


7-8194
rastochnik
2002-07-26 16:40
2002.10.03
compaq armada 7400 - подскажите, как в bios попасть?


1-8046
Metotrone
2002-09-22 17:45
2002.10.03
Создание файла


7-8185
wdr
2002-07-23 08:23
2002.10.03
Try..Except...


14-8116
Oleg_Gashev
2002-09-04 23:54
2002.10.03
Работа